键盘事件

如何为HTML地图组件添加可访问性?-小浪学习网

如何为HTML地图组件添加可访问性?

提升html地图组件可访问性的核心方法包括:1. 使用alt属性为图像热区提供清晰描述;2. 利用aria属性如aria-label、aria-describedby、aria-expanded和aria-controls增强语义和交互提示;3. 添加...
站长的头像-小浪学习网站长28天前
336
js怎么处理键盘方向键事件-小浪学习网

js怎么处理键盘方向键事件

在javascript中处理键盘方向键事件可以通过监听keydown和keyup事件实现。1)添加事件监听器捕获键盘事件,使用switch语句处理arrowup、arrowdown、arrowleft、arrowright键。2)使用状态对象跟...
站长的头像-小浪学习网站长2个月前
339
HTML输入框粘贴内容自动提取首词教程-小浪学习网

HTML输入框粘贴内容自动提取首词教程

本教程旨在详细指导如何在用户向HTML输入框粘贴文本时,通过JavaScript(结合jQuery)自动截取并仅保留粘贴内容中的第一个词。我们将重点介绍如何利用paste事件监听、安全地获取剪贴板数据以及...
站长的头像-小浪学习网站长28天前
3311
禁用按钮悬停事件处理与提示信息显示指南-小浪学习网

禁用按钮悬停事件处理与提示信息显示指南

本教程旨在解决禁用状态下HTML按钮无法触发悬停事件,进而显示关联提示信息的问题。我们将深入探讨原生CSS和jQuery方案失效的原因,并提供两种有效的替代策略:一是模拟禁用状态,通过CSS和Java...
站长的头像-小浪学习网站长18小时前
3213
HTML按钮如何美化_悬停与点击状态设计-小浪学习网

HTML按钮如何美化_悬停与点击状态设计

要美化html按钮并设计悬停与点击状态,需运用css伪类选择器。1. 首先设置基础样式,包括背景色、文字颜色、内边距、圆角、字体等,使按钮具备视觉可识别性;2. 然后通过:hover伪类实现悬停效果...
站长的头像-小浪学习网站长29天前
3212
HTML中的ARIA角色是什么?如何使用?-小浪学习网

HTML中的ARIA角色是什么?如何使用?

aria角色是html中用于增强网页可访问性的重要工具,它通过向辅助技术提供页面元素功能信息,帮助残障人士更好地使用网页。1. aria角色定义了元素“是什么”,而非“看起来像什么”,例如用role=...
站长的头像-小浪学习网站长27天前
3214
HTML如何制作迷宫游戏?路径寻找怎么实现?-小浪学习网

HTML如何制作迷宫游戏?路径寻找怎么实现?

迷宫游戏的核心是javascript,html和css仅负责结构和样式,真正实现迷宫生成与寻路的是js。1. 迷宫通常用canvas绘制,性能优于div网格;2. 迷宫数据结构为二维数组,0为通路,1为墙壁;3. 生成...
站长的头像-小浪学习网站长8天前
318
处理HTML禁用按钮的悬停事件与提示信息显示-小浪学习网

处理HTML禁用按钮的悬停事件与提示信息显示

本文探讨了在HTML中为禁用按钮(disabled属性)实现悬停(hover)事件并显示关联提示信息的策略。由于浏览器对禁用元素的事件限制,传统的CSS选择器和JavaScript事件监听器往往无效。教程将深入...
站长的头像-小浪学习网站长16小时前
319
JavaScript 键盘重复延迟问题的解决方案-小浪学习网

JavaScript 键盘重复延迟问题的解决方案

本文旨在解决 JavaScript 中使用键盘控制游戏时,按键重复响应过快的问题。通过使用 setInterval 函数和记录按键状态,实现平滑的角色移动效果。文章将提供详细的代码示例和解释,帮助开发者避...
站长的头像-小浪学习网站长34天前
3114
怎样用JavaScript实现一个简单的贪吃蛇游戏?-小浪学习网

怎样用JavaScript实现一个简单的贪吃蛇游戏?

游戏的核心循环通过setinterval驱动,分为更新和绘制两个阶段。1. 更新阶段处理蛇的移动、碰撞检测和食物逻辑;2. 绘制阶段将最新状态渲染到canvas上。蛇的移动通过计算新头部位置并更新数组实...
站长的头像-小浪学习网站长40天前
306